Visas issued by US carriers/cruise lines for travel to Cuba are supposed to be "pink". I suspect yours is green.

That said, suppliers of visas are supposed to ensure you are eligible for the type of visa you have purchased. If there is going to be a problem, it might be more of an issue when boarding your cruise rather than at Cuban immigration.

I have in the past emailed Aduana and got helpful replies, so if you are still concerned, maybe that's a good next step.

I am Canadian and when I contacted the Cuban embassy in Ottawa they said I had to purchase the Visa (travel card) from the ship. (If I could have obtained it in Ottawa it cost half the price but they said I was not able to use that one). U.S. based ships are making the extra money they told me.
